Virginia Beach
City Public Schools, VA
- Virginia Beach
City Public Schools is the largest school division in Hampton Roads
southeastern Virginia serving approximately 69,565 students
in grades K-12. Currently, the school system includes 56 elementary
schools, 14 middle schools, 11 high schools, and a number of secondary/post-secondary
specialty centers, including the Renaissance Academy, Advanced Technology
Center, Technical and Career Education Center, and Adult Learning Center.

Mission and Vision
|
- District slogan:
"A commitment to provide all students with the necessary skills
to thrive as 21st century learners, workers, and citizens."
- Mission
and Vision Statements . Vision Statement: Every student is achieving
at his or her maximum potential in an engaging, inspiring and challenging
learning environment. Mission Statement: The Virginia Beach City Public
Schools, in partnership with the entire community, will empower every
student to become a life-long learner who is a responsible, productive
and engaged citizen within the global community.
